Suspect found in attic after standoff

Updated: Thursday, 21 Feb 2013, 6:16 AM EST
Published : Wednesday, 20 Feb 2013, 12:04 PM EST

VIRGINIA BEACH, Va. (WAVY) - Police say a suspect who barricaded himself inside of an apartment was found in the attic Wednesday afternoon.

Grazia Moyers with the Virginia Beach Police Department said Virginia Beach officers were dispatched at 8:10 a.m . to the 1600 block of Chase Arbor Common to assist Norfolk officers with a barricaded suspect.

Michael Augustus was wanted for questioning in connection to crimes that occurred in the City of Norfolk. Chris Amos with the Norfolk Police Department told WAVY News' Lauren Compton Augustus was wanted on a probation violation.

Around 10:45 a.m., Virginia Beach’s SWAT team was dispatched to the scene. Police also utilized a robotic camera and tear gas before they entered the apartment.

Augustus was located inside an attic just after 3 p.m. Tuesday.

Nearby residents were evacuated. Green Meadows and Chase Arbor Common were closed.

WAVY.com dug into Augustine's record, which includes convictions for possession of controlled substance, marijuana and cocaine.
